How Portugal just kicked off 48 projects through the Active Citizens Fund

Over the next three years, no less than 48 projects are set to receive up to €3,5M through the Portuguese Active Citizens Fund. The funding will go to projects focusing on civic participation and human rights awareness, as well as projects dealing with the empowerment of vulnerable groups, such as youth at risk, young people with disabilities, children living with cancer, victims of domestic violence, migrants and refugees.

Portugal ACF

The Active Citizens Fund 2014-2021 focuses on developing long-term sustainability and capacity of the civil society sector, with the aim of strengthening its role in promoting democratic participation, active citizenship and human rights. Almost two hundred applications were submitted in October 2018 to the Portuguese Active Citizens Fund, demonstrating just how important support to civil society is.
